Pain in the back, hips, shoulders and knees, as well as other musculo-skeletal problems, is frequently due to pelvic instability and misalignment.

Pelvic misalignment can be corrected by a visit to an osteopath or chiropractor, but the pelvis does not stay in alignment. As well as current pain and discomfort, this can lead to serious longer-term problems (such as hip replacement).

The ABSPC is an effective and well proven system for diagnosing and correcting pelvic misalignment. Simple exercises which take just a few minutes each day enable individuals to correct and maintain pelvic alignment after initial treatment and instruction.
